Transaction 13680dab30e9913c19578aecfeb0de36913385cb8cfd5a66839855dae98e911e
1 Input
1 Output
-
13680dab30e9913c19578aecfeb0de36913385cb8cfd5a66839855dae98e911e:0
- value
- 556497
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4de6b4ac2c088ac5991ff00a54eea2d9ddb46572 OP_EQUALVERIFY OP_CHECKSIG
- address
- 186uQVHMd3UiKndhZZp8xJTx3uBmUTpg9H